These … WebFeb 27, 2024 · Molds – Most concrete molds are made from urethane rubbers, which are designed to be resistant to concrete bonding. Paint – Paint is another material that has no natural bonding agents, so concrete generally won’t stick to it very well. Oil – Oil or oiled surfaces are often used to make the surface resistant to concrete bonding.

WebGE 380722 Rubber Glue If you’re looking for a strong glue for rubber, the GE 380722 Premium Rubber Glue may be the one for you! This glue is a great craft adhesive. It’s great for bonding wood, fabric, leather, ceramic, glass, and metal in addition to rubber. This glue is a thin viscosity, so it’s a great choice for more delicate projects. WebOct 22, 2024 · Arrange all your glue bottles in a circle with 1-in. spacing between the bottles. Add 2 in. to the circle diameter and cut out two 3/4-in. plywood discs. Drill 7/8-in. holes in the center of each one. Measure the various bottle diameters and drill storage holes around the top disc a smidgen larger than the bottles.

WebStep 1 Roughen the surface of the wood with 80-grit sandpaper. Rub continuously in a circular motion over the surface that the foam will be glued to. This creates a more porous surface, allowing the cement to penetrate the wood.
